What a Root Shadow Actually Does
A root shadow is a controlled, a little deeper tone at the bottom that blurs the boundary among pure boom and lightened hair. It is just not a harsh block of colour. Think watercolor wash that regularly fades into lighter mids and ends. The top-quality ones mimic the approach solar-bleached hair shifts from darker scalp towards lighter lengths.
A Tint Touch Up, however, pursuits regrowth on the scalp to preserve a good base color. When prospects need to hide grays or avert their stage consistent, we observe tint to new improvement and, if obligatory, refresh the mid-lengths with a scale down developer or demi-everlasting. On highlighted or balayaged hair, that tint can strengthen the root shadow, so the total impression is cohesive. The two facilities are usually not opposites. They are methods that can be layered, continuously in the same consultation.
The knowledge of mixing them suggests up a month later. Without a root shadow, a highlight can develop out with a stark line that calls for preservation at 4 to 6 weeks. With a shadow, the “line of demarcation” seems softer and you're able to stretch to 8 or ten weeks, routinely longer, relying on distinction and your cut.

Product Choices: Demi, Permanent, and Glaze
There is a intent many execs achieve for demi-permanent shade for root shadows. Demis deposit tone devoid of increasing the cuticle as aggressively as permanent dye, which retains the transition cushy and continues hair feeling like hair. I choose low-alkaline demis for mixing highlights, often in a shade part to at least one level deeper than the target base. On enormously porous ends, I will mixture with a clean gloss to slow the grab.
Permanent colour stays a smart resolution for a Tint Touch Up whilst grey insurance policy issues. If you've got 50 to 100 % gray, a everlasting tint at the basis controls insurance plan, and we can still glaze mids and ends to harmonize all the pieces. For buyers with 10 to 40 % grey, a demi-permanent tint in general covers satisfactory, and the fade is extra forgiving.
Glazes and toners deliver the entire photograph in combination. After a root shadow and Tint Touch Up, a sheer glaze across mids and ends balances warmness and adds mirrored image. On blonde highlights, violet or blue-violet policies out brass. On brunettes, green or blue-dependent glazes minimize orange without dulling the hair.
Technique: Where the Brush Lands
Placement subjects greater than product. A root shadow could land deeper wherein the hair could be darkest naturally, veritably the excellent and crown, with a softer presence round the hairline. I like to start the shadow approximately 1 / 4 to a half of inch from the front hairline for prospects who concern darkness, then weave it closer on the sides so the mixture reads typical.
For balayage or teasylights, I feather the shadow with a huge brush, then “smudge” the road with a tint brush grew to become sideways. On foiled blondes, I apply the shadow after rinsing foils and drying the root area, tapping the colour onto the demarcation line and dragging it down one to 2 inches based at the wanted soften. Fine hair necessities lighter tension and shorter drag. Coarse or curly hair can take a longer shadow area for visual balance.
When a Tint Touch Up is part of the plan, I follow the foundation tint first on dry hair, technique to objective, then emulsify the tint on the bowl to melt the edge in the past applying the root shadow. If a client has a delicate scalp, I upload a protective serum or pre-healing and hinder builders mild. Comfort is not really not obligatory.

Hair Health: Treatments, Smoothing Systems, and Perm Waving
Color seems to be high-priced whilst hair is healthful. Before and after a shadow or tint, I check elasticity and porosity. If the hair stretches like taffy and does now not get better, we upload a bond-construction hair therapy and protein at modest doses, then moisture to shop flexibility. Porous mids grab ash instant, so I repeatedly pre-fill with warm glazes on the equal day or per week previous.
Smoothing Systems and chemical straightening trade how color behaves. Keratin-taste healing procedures can seal the cuticle and shift tone warmer. I plan shade first, then smoothing two to seven days later to hinder tonal waft. During smoothing, I cut warmness passes around the hairline to protect delicate highlights.
Perm Waving provides texture and opens the cuticle. If a patron needs each a perm and a refreshing shade mixture, I schedule colour as a minimum every week after perming, oftentimes two, to let the cuticle to settle. If time or price range in simple terms facilitates one service now, coloration first, perm later hazards lifting or transferring your root shadow. Better to perm first, then tone and shadow with light formulation as soon as the hair calms down.

The At-Home Gap: How To Make It Last
Even the exceptional salon work will likely be undone by using harsh water and too-hot tools. Hard water introduces minerals that turn faded blondes brassy and brunettes muddy. A weekly chelating wash or a showerhead clear out can stretch the lifestyles of your tone through a few weeks. Heat styling at three hundred to 340 F for first-class to medium hair and 340 to 380 F for coarse hair prevents color shift and dryness. Higher warmness scorches toners off the cuticle and makes shadows fade unevenly.
If your scalp is delicate, stay Skin Care sensibilities in mind. Fragrance-unfastened shampoos, mild exfoliating scalp scrubs as soon as each and every one to two weeks, and averting nails-on-scalp scratching lengthen each convenience and colour. Remember, the scalp is pores and skin. Treating it kindly improves how tint absorbs and how calmly your root shadow reads.

How Often Should You Come Back?
Frequency relies on evaluation. If your herbal root is a point four brunette and your highlights are living at a degree nine, you possibly can be aware regrowth sooner. A gentle root shadow buys time, yet be expecting visits each six to eight weeks while you wish steady brightness. If you're a point 6 melting into level eight caramel, you'll more often than not live happily on the 8 to ten week mark. Gray protection brings you back sooner, as a rule 4 to 6 weeks, though gray mixing stretches to eight in many circumstances.
Budget and calendar remember as a lot as hair. I quite often alternate smaller upkeep visits with higher refreshes. One visit may encompass a Tint Touch Up, instant root shadow, and gloss. The next will be a partial highlight with a stronger face body and a deeper shadow, notably formerly a season trade.
